I'm looking at a CJ at an auction tomarrow. It is an old county Jeep,but I'm confused about the vin.. there is a plate but no paper work.

The vin is 1jcbm85e5bt..... Everything I find says the jeep is an 84 CJ5 , which is quit strange since they stopped making them in 1983.

Is this something that was made for Government use back in the olden days or is something afoot at the Circle-K

If this is a rare CJ I'll pick it up. If not I won't buy it for the simple fact that here in Ca. we have smog laws and anything over 1975 has to be smogged, and I dont feel like messing with it. Thanks

1jcbm85e5bt - I manufactured in the US
J - Jeep Corp
C- MVP (type)
B- GM 151 cubic in 2.5 liter 2V 1-4 Ponticac Motor Div. - Gasoline
M- 4 speed manual Fir
85- CJ5
E- 4150 (GVWR)
5- ? (listed for all models as the "check #")
B- 1981 (model year)
T-Toledo Plant (where made)
